Analysis
Zimbabwe recorded 4,714 1000 USD for mozambique — paper and paperboard, excluding newsprint — export value in 2018. That is the highest value across all 14 years on record.
The figure is up 3,963.8% on the previous year and up 29,362.5% over ten years.
Over the whole period, mozambique — paper and paperboard, excluding newsprint — export value in Zimbabwe peaked at 4,714 1000 USD in 2018 and was at its lowest, 2 1000 USD, in 2007.
Zimbabwe ranks 3rd of 29 countries on this measure, in the top 10%.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
